My daughter Jolene currently lives in Holland and I am hoping to raise enough money to bring her home to the UK to be with me.

In 2011, at age 35 Jo developed a growth on her spine.

This was detected too late and two operations were unable to prevent permanent paralysis.
This was a devastating blow for Jo, prior to this an active, outgoing, young lady, now left wheelchair bound, incontinent and facing struggles with her mental health.

After spending 2 years in hospital Jo had to leave her home of 13 years and move into an apartment for people with physical health needs, requiring access to 24-hour support.


In 2015, after extensive rehabilitation and physiotherapy Jo was able to visit me for a holiday, but sadly while here developed Sepsis, leading to multiple organ failure requiring 14 months in and out of hospital, 6 weeks of which was spent in an induced coma. Further complications in hospital left Jo with right arm and hand paralysis. Jo is very creative and enjoys art, craft and embroidery but is now unable to carry out her passion as she once did. 


Although Jo faced a hard battle to regain her memory and learn to speak again, these haven’t fully recovered. Jo struggles with her short-term memory and her speech is slow.


My hope at the time was for Jo to live with me so that I could care for her, but unfortunately due to circumstances beyond my control this was not possible and Jo had to be repatriated back to Holland directly from hospital in the UK to hospital there, before returning to the apartment and continuing her rehabilitation.

Jo is now chronically ill and highly susceptible to life-threatening infection.

Jo was receiving regular support and visits from her grandparents who also live in Holland, but these visits are less frequent given their age and own health conditions.


In spite of her ongoing struggles, Jo continues to smile and maintain a positive outlook.

I visit Jo as often as I can,  facetime her every evening, and have taken long periods of time off work unpaid to be there to support her, but I am no longer able to financially sustain this, having used every resource available to me. I considered moving back to Holland to support Jo, but having explored every avenue of this, finding a home, and a new job at the age of 63 proved to be impossible for me, Jo’s wish for some time has been to come home and be with the rest of her family so that we can better support her and look after her care needs.

I am now seeking to raise funds for the cost of bringing Jo home, as simply catching a flight is not an option for her.

To travel Jo would need transporting by staffed ambulance over land and sea with necessary medical equipment on-board. Her wheelchair needs to be transported separately via air, but this needs co-ordinating to arrive before she does. We would also need to arrange shipping of her posessions, clothes, and essential medical supplies needed for her ongoing care.


To put this into context, the cost of the ambulance and staff provision alone has been quoted to me at £17,000. Added to this various costs involved with moving her belongings and for me to be able to be with her to support her throughout the move and this is just the beginning of Jo's Journey home.

Once she arrives there are further costs involved in finding a suitably adapted home for her and providing a 24-hour care package to give her back a quality of life, whilst in the comfort of being around family who can help her to gain back some independence.
